Vietnam's seafood exports and imports in 5 months of 2026
Friday, July 3,2026
AsemconnectVietnam - According to data from the Vietnam Customs Department, in May of 2026, Vietnam's seafood exports reached US$1.02 billion, a slight increase of 0.65% compared to April of 2026.
This brought the total value of Vietnam's seafood exports in the first five months of 2026 to nearly US$4.7 billion, an increase of nearly 11% compared to the same period last year.
Meanwhile, Vietnam's total seafood imports in the first five months of 2026 reached over US$1.28 billion, a slight decrease of 1.64% compared to the same period in 2025. In May of 2026 alone, the import value reached US$253.64 million, a decrease of 8.96% compared to April of 2026.
Vietnam's main seafood export markets in the first six months of 2026
China has become Vietnam's largest seafood export market, with a turnover of US$1.16 billion, an increase of over 41.7% compared to the same period of 2025 and accounting for nearly 25% of our country's total export turnover.
However, Vietnam's seafood exports to traditional markets such as the United States and the European Union (EU) recorded a decline in the first six months of this year. Seafood exports to the United States reached over US$702 million, a decrease of nearly 8.4%; while exports to the EU market reached nearly US$420 million, a decrease of 2.4%.
Vietnam's main seafood import markets in the first six months of 2026
India continued to affirm its position as Vietnam's largest seafood import market. In the first five months of the year, imports from this market reached US$205.4 million, accounting for nearly 16% of the total import value of the entire industry and increasing by 8.2% compared to the same period of 2025.
The imports from Japan reached US$139.74 million, an increase of over 43% compared to the same period in 2025; while imports from the United States reached nearly US$48.3 million, a sharp increase of 74.5%; and imports from Canada reached over US$13 million, a growth of nearly 64.5%.
However, seafood imports from Southeast Asian markets decreased sharply by nearly 25.3%, reaching nearly US$178 million.
